Bandhavgarh Tiger Reserve normally receives tourists between October and June, whereas core areas are closed throughout the monsoon season. Some of the main core safari areas of the park include Tala, Magadhi, and Khitoulis.

2 Nights 3 Days: Best Plan for First-Time Visitors
The most balanced trip is a 2-night, 3-day trip. You have ample time, and you are not in a hurry. Besides, two or three safaris can also be enjoyed during this stay. This provides enhanced opportunities for viewing tigers, deer, birds, and forest scenes.
A basic plan might appear as follows:
- Day 1: Arrival, checking in, and relaxing.
- Day 2: Take a morning and evening safari.
- Day 3: Take a morning safari and depart.

3 Nights 4 Days: Best for Tiger Lovers
In case you really want to have a powerful safari experience, then 3 nights and 4 days would be the ideal choice. This plan permits four to five safaris, depending on the availability of permits. There are also other zones that you can visit during your stay.
Bandhavgarh has inner areas such as Tala, Magadhi, and Khitoul. It also has buffer zones such as Dhamokhar, Johila, and Panpatha. Thus, extension of stay will assist you in traveling more routes. These core and buffer zones are included in the list of official tourism information to plan a safari.

How Many Safaris Are Enough in Bandhavgarh?
To have a good trip, make at least three safaris. A single safari is too dangerous when sightseeing is important to you. Two safaris are okay, yet restricted. Better chances are provided by three to four safaris.
The following is just a basic guide:
- 1 safari: very short experience
- 2 tours: simple walk in the forest.
- 3 safaris: excellent first-time safari.
- 4 safaris: a more promising opportunity to see tigers.
- 5 or more safaris: ideal when you love wildlife.
